Cowardly Management and Bad Pay Practices
Pros
3 Days off per week and good starting pay for area.
Cons
Hours worked are unpredictable. You are scheduled for 4 days 10 hours or 5 days 8 hours but routinely stay after to finish the days work. It is rare but definitely not unheard of to work 7:30 am till 10 or 11 pm. You will rarely receive a thank you or recognition of the long hours and it is impossible to plan anything after work. Management is cowardly and borderline communist in their employee review and pay practices. No matter what you do you will receive the same performance review and the same raise. Someone who coasts along and does the absolute minimum will receive the same review as someone who volunteers for extra work or is given lots of extra work. If you get hired here do the absolute minimum. There is zero reason to do other wise. They will erase raises you got for longevity if you get moved to the next rank because everyone who gets moved up to the next rank will get the same pay. For example, if you make $17.85 because of longevity and another newer employee makes $17.00 and you both get promoted to the next rank you will start over at $18.50. Meaning your pay raise is less than the newer employee. Longevity means nothing to these people. They view you as 100% replaceable. They are cowardly.
